Increase Your Power and Overall Strength

If you’re looking to increase the strength of your body, a slam ball is the ultimate piece of equipment for doing this. Strength is not only needed for lifting heavy things, it’s important for utilising a wide range of movement, helping you do things much easier and with much less strain on your body and joints.

Push exercises help you increase explosive power and strength. This is especially ideal for those who take part in many sports, from baseball and tennis to golf. There are a multitude of push exercises that you can do with a slamball 10kg.

One example of a great push exercise that you can do with a medicine ball is the ‘ball throw downs’. This is where you jump up and in a burst of explosive power throw the ball down to the ground. This is a great full-body workout, improving your overall strength by increasing power in your arms, shoulders, thighs, glutes and core, while also helping to burn fat.

Cardio Fitness

When wanting to improve your cardio fitness, many people often think about using treadmills or the bike machine. However, one piece of equipment many people often neglect when cardio is concerned is the slam ball. To back this up, one recent study found that slam ball exercises are equivalent to conventional cardioexercises in terms of strain, such as running or swimming.

Another reason why slam balls can be such an effective option for cardio fitness, like the 5,10 or 15kg slam ball, is because they can be incorporated into mixed cardio exercises that focus on strength and stamina.

One great example of a cardio workout that utilises the slam ball is the ball toss to burpee. This one has great benefits for your cardio fitness. By throwing the ball upwards, catching it, and then letting it go before doing a burpee and repeating the movement, you can get your blood flowing and increase your cardiovascular strength.

Injury Recovery Benefits

One underlooked benefit to slam balls is the advantages they bring to many workouts used for those recovering from injury. They help your body regenerate and increase endurance and the overall response of your body. In particular, they specifically help those recovering from spine, knees and shoulder injuries.

When recovering from injury, it is advised to use lighter balls than the ones you usually use when wanting to improve your strength or cardiovascular fitness. This is so you don’t aggravate the injury.

By slowly increasing the weight over time, you are less likely to get injured and will be able to recover fully so that you can use the weight you originally used before the injury without the risk of hurting the muscles and joints.

When recovering from an injury, one of the main workouts you should do is core exercises. This is because the core ensures that the whole body is supported by the main muscles you need to move around and do your daily activities without injury.

The Russian Twist is a workout that is often used in injury recovery due to how easy it is to perform. All you have to do is sit in an upright position, and move the slam ball with both hands from the left side of your body to the right side while twisting your torso to the relevant side. This is great, as it doesn’t put too much strain on your joints, while massively strengthening your core.
